I am 18 years old and was diagnosed with PCOD / PCOS in December after missing my period for two months. I took progesterone tablets to induce my period. Since then, I have been on homeopathy but it has been almost four months since I have got my period. I have gained weight in the past two years and I feel that is a major factor in this (60 kgs) What steps should I take

PCOD u tend u gain weight. U need to exercise regularly and consume less caloric more fibrous food. After significant weight loss your periods will slowly normalise.
